Elliot House is a Clubhouse International accredited Clubhouse and plays an active role in the Massachusetts Clubhouse Coalition. Our Clubhouses offer adults with a history of mental illness a community built on peer support and rehabilitation principles. These recovery-oriented programs help individuals gain employment and build independent living skills. Clubhouse members and staff work together in all phases of clubhouse operations, including business management and food service.
